FOUR PLAY
As daylight crept away, defeated
A darkness called me to be seated
Beneath a tree that was no more
Beside a silenced, absent, shore
a cold wind chuckles
passersby turn from her greeting
cul-de-sac trash swirls
a fallen sparrow
feathers riffle in the cold
a bitter wind howls
their hats now tilted
snowmen lean into the sun
carrots sniffing springtime
